Overcoming Fears in Career Transitions - Traci Stoop's Journey From Teacher to Photographer

In this episode of Roots and Roofs, host Mackenzie Shelton speaks with Traci Stoop, who shares her inspiring journey from being a science teacher to a full-time photographer and mentor. They discuss the challenges and fears associated with career transitions, the importance of family dynamics in entrepreneurship, and the significance of creating a balanced daily routine. Traci emphasizes the need for personal growth and reframing guilt as a working mom, while also providing valuable advice for other mothers seeking change in their careers.

Time Stamps:

01:17 Traci Stoop's Journey from Teaching to Photography

06:16 Overcoming Fears in Career Transition

10:28 The Impact of Teaching on Photography Business

12:40 Navigating Family Dynamics in Entrepreneurship

21:45 Creating a Balanced Daily Routine

24:38 Reframing Guilt as a Working Mom

27:57 Personal Growth Through Entrepreneurship

32:41 Advice for Moms Seeking Change
